## Monthly Partitioning

Event tables in Larchpond are partitioned by calendar month, and the partition-creation job runs on the 25th to pre-create the next month. If inserts fail near month boundaries, the job likely skipped — create the partition manually before anything else. The exact procedure and naming convention are documented on the internal page.

dashboard of tafog-yahip = https://vault.nelvrostack.test/merge_requests/board/view/job/display/view/pipeline/8e82a165cad055904c4325ad

Handover note — cold storage archiving. Finishing my rotation, so a quick summary for plugin authors: the Brindle archiver now moves buckets idle for 180 days into glacier tier, and plugins must handle the restore-latency callback. Retries are automatic; don't re-trigger manually. The archiving API reference and callback examples are here.

dashboard of yajeg-tawif = https://grafana.nelvrohq.internal/settings/deploy/board/spaces/c3dc1ffa01438d1d

### Runbook: Payment Retry Rollout

Quick reminder before you flip the flag: the Tollgate payments worker now stamps every retry with an idempotency key derived from the original charge intent, so duplicate captures shouldn't happen even if the queue replays. Watch the dedupe-hit metric for the first hour — a flat line means the middleware isn't wired in. Once metrics look sane, promote the build through the signed pipeline. The pipeline accepts artifacts signed with this key:

release key, kahif-yagap: bky3_1JN

### Runbook: Report export timezone mismatches (Glimmerfield)

If a customer reports that exported totals differ from the dashboard, check whether their report schedule predates the March cutover — older schedules still render in server-local time rather than the account timezone. Re-saving the schedule fixes it. Before escalating, confirm the export worker is running with the expected timezone settings shown below.

config for kadup-kajog:
[raldor]
host = raldor.tolvaqworks.internal
user = raldor_svc
database = raldor_prod